About Devil Creek Campground

Devil Creek Campground is located 32 miles southeast of West Glacier, Montana, and six miles west of Marias Pass, a high mountain pass located in Glacier National Park. This location has 13 campsites, 7 which are reservable and 6 that are walk-up sites. The stay limit is 16 consecutive nights.

Policies & Rules

Category About
General

CHECK OUT TIME IS 11:00 A.M. Check in time is at 2:00 p.m.

General

If a site is not available for reservation online, it is shown as a first-come first-served (FF) or walk in (W) site. These sites will be identified on campground maps and campsite post markers with a W. First-come, First-served sites may already be taken as this cannot be updated on the Recreation.gov website. You may try to call for availability.

General

Reserved sites will be held until check out time (11am) the following day. Sites must be occupied by checkout of that day to hold a reservation or the site will be forfeited and released.  

General

We do not allow reservation holders to change campsites and move to a Walk-up campsite upon arrival. Most of our campsites are available for advanced reservations, and you must occupy the site you reserve.

General

You are allowed 2 passenger vehicles per site, the first vehicle is included in the site fee and an extra vehicle charge of $5.00/vehicle per night will be collected at the campground. Sites that are identified as double occupancy can accommodate an additional camping unit. In this situation, you will be charged for each camper.

General

Drop Camping is illegal without a Forest Service permit. If you rent a camper it may not be deivered by the owner.

General

There is a food storage order in effect on the Flathead National Forest. Know how to store all attractants all the time. See your Campground Host for more information or visit: https://www.fs.usda.gov/detail/flathead/recreation/?cid=stelprdb5347448  

General

Don't Move Firewood: Prevent the spread of tree-killing pests by obtaining firewood near your destination and burning it on-site. For more information visit dontmovefirewood.org.
